I have a XFX 6600gt 128mb AGP card and it is flaking out on me. It started about 2 days ago only while running WoW, the screen would go black and come back off and on. This got worse and if I would alt-tab to the desk top it would stop for a bit (I know I should have stopped but it is my gf's rig and I was busy). So I started paying more attention and it is at the point where when I boot the system it's fine until the windows logo..then it goes black and thats it. The system is still on and there seems to be HD activity but no picture. I have changed monitors and still no different.

I have a home build system:
Mobo: Asus A7NBX-E
CPU: XP 3200+ Barton
Mem: 2 Gigs DDR-400
PS: Enermax Whisper EG465P-VE (430 watts)
(aofc) Video: XFX 6600gt 128mb AGP.

Guess the question really is, is the card going bad? Like I said I tried another working monitor and it was the same result. I reseated (sp) and cleaned every connection and card and I do not have another card to test against.
